Senior Engineering Lead – Design & Aerostructures

Location: Lindsay, Ontario, Canada
Salary: C$165,000 - C$210,000
Employment Type: Full-time
Work Model: Hybrid

About the Role
A senior-level Engineering Lead – Design & Aerostructures is sought to lead the development of mechanical and structural systems for next-generation eVTOL aircraft. This role combines hands-on product development with leadership of the engineering team, guiding the technical strategy, tools, methods, and processes for both developmental and certified aircraft.

What You'll Do

  • Lead and mentor the Design & Aerostructures team, setting technical direction, goals, and priorities.

  • Architect, design, and implement mechanical system architectures from aircraft to component level.

  • Design critical structural components including fuselage, propulsion mounts, landing gear, and system housings.

  • Specify and validate materials (e.g., composites, aluminum, titanium, high-performance polymers) for strength, weight, thermal, and durability performance.

  • Oversee product development from concept through prototyping, testing, and production release.

  • Optimize structures for strength, stiffness, fatigue, and thermal performance.

  • Interface with suppliers to validate materials, manufacturing methods, and fabrication constraints.

  • Participate in failure investigations and root cause analyses for material or mechanical performance issues.

  • Develop test infrastructure to verify platform performance and support certification.

  • Identify and establish strategic partnerships with external organizations and research institutions.

  • Ensure compliance with industry regulations and eVTOL certification requirements.

  • Continuously improve processes, tools, and team capabilities.

What You'll Bring

  • 5+ years in senior engineering or technology leadership roles within aerospace, with primary structural systems experience (composite design and stress disciplines preferred).

  • Full lifecycle experience in at least one aerospace program, from concept to production and certification.

  • Familiarity with eVTOL Certification regulations (TCCA, FAA, EASA).

  • Hands-on experience with CAD tools (SolidWorks, CATIA V6, 3DExperience preferred).

  • Strong leadership, mentoring, and cross-functional collaboration skills.

  • Proactive mindset, problem-solving abilities, and a drive to innovate.
